Obituary for Patrick J. Recla

Patrick J.  Recla
Patrick J. Recla, 85, of Niagara, passed away Saturday, Feb. 28, 2015, at the Oscar G. Johnson Veteran’s Hospital, Iron Mountain, Mich.

He was born on Valentine’s Day, February 14, 1930, in Norway, Mich., son of the late Roy and Emily (Canavera) Recla.

Pat graduated from Niagara High School and as a young man worked for the Kimberly Clark Paper Mill. He served his country in the United States Army from 1951-1953. Upon discharge he returned to Niagara and worked at the paper mill until he retired in 1992, after 45 years. Pat read the water meters in Niagara for 25 years.

He married the love of his life, Kathleen Gordon on April 16, 1955, in Niagara and they resided there until 1993, when they moved “Out to the Lake”. They would have celebrated 60 years of marriage in just 2 short months.

Pat loved his garden, woodworking, hunting, fishing, his motorcycle, playing cards, but most of all loved his family and getting together with food and drinks. He was an exceptional man who instilled a strong work ethic, values and common sense in his children and grandchildren.

He is survived by loving wife, Kathleen; two sons, Patrick (LouAnn) Recla, Marinette, Wis. and Daniel “Rouch” (Sandy “Tweet”) Recla, Niagara; five daughters, Debbie (Randy) Wodenka, Lori (Daniel) Aderman, Julie (Bob) Butler, Betsy Shampo (Bruce), all of Niagara and Amy (John) Zipp, Fond du Lac, Wis; one brother, Eugene Recla; one step-brother, William Ruelle; sixteen grandchildren, Emily (Brent) Allred, Alisyn (Brian) Baciak, Tony (Julie) Wodenka, Michael and Ashley (Sam) Aderman, Katie (Bryan) Thomson, Rachel (Mike) Reese, Liz (Ryan) Butler, Austin Recla, Joshua (Stephanie) and Joel Recla, Ian and Corrina Shampo, Madi, Miranda, and Maike Zipp. Pat was blessed to have eight great-grandchildren, Porter, McKenna, Eliza, Liam, Carly, Gage, Nora, Paige and many nieces and nephews.

Pat was welcomed to Heaven by his sister, Bernadine Sundquist; his parents; his father and mother-in-law, Rose and Irish Gordon; his brothers-in-law, Tuffy and Jerry Gordon; step-father, Ed Ruelle and grand-babies, Matthew and Danielle.

He was blessed with a wonderful life, a family that loved him and each other and many, many close friends. He will be greatly missed and fondly remembered by all.
